As seen in the example in figure 1, imagine two collaborators begin with a document that has the characters “abc”. The collaborator on the left decides to add the character ‘x’ at index 0 and, at the same time, the collaborator on the right decides to delete the character ‘c’. Without OT, the first collaborator will end up deleting the wrong character because after they prepend ‘x’the character 'c' is no longer at index 2. What needs to happen instead is that the first collaborator performs a transformed version of the delete operation, which deletes the correct character at index 3. The second collaborator doesn’t need any transformations in this case because after deleting the character at index 2 then prepending ‘x’ leads to both documents being consistent.
